Closing & Partial Close

Closing does not require oracle data — the keeper supplies the settlement price. All close functions are on the Diamond.

Full close

solidity
function closeTrade(bytes32 positionHash) external;
function closeTrade(bytes32 positionHash, uint24 broker) external;

The two-argument form credits the close fee to a broker id. Use 0 or the single-argument form if you do not operate a broker integration.

The close broker is independent of the open broker

The broker recorded when the position was opened does not carry over. Whatever id you pass here receives the close-fee share — and the single-argument form credits the default broker. A broker integration must pass its id on the close as well as the open. See Brokers & Referrals.

WARNING

Solidity overloads share a name. If you put every closeTrade variant into one ABI array, viem cannot tell them apart — pass only the fragment you intend to call, or disambiguate explicitly.

A full close also cancels every TP/SL order attached to that position, each emitting DecreaseOrderCancelled.

Partial close

solidity
function closeTrade(bytes32 positionHash, uint128 closeQty, uint24 broker) external;

Closes closeQty of the position and leaves the rest open. The remainder keeps its entry price, and accrued funding and holding fees are split proportionally.

closeQtyResult
0Full close
>= position.qtyFull close
BetweenPartial close, remainder stays open

closeQty uses the same 1e10 scale as qty — see Precision & Units.

Merged positions only

Partial close requires a position with a deterministic key. Legacy positions created before the merged-position upgrade are full-close only, and a partial request against one reverts. See Positions are merged slots.

Finding the position hash

Three ways, in order of convenience:

ts
// 1. Compute it — no RPC call needed.
import { keccak256, encodeAbiParameters } from 'viem'

const positionHash = keccak256(
  encodeAbiParameters(
    [{ type: 'address' }, { type: 'address' }, { type: 'bool' }, { type: 'address' }, { type: 'string' }],
    [user, pairBase, isLong, lvToken, 'position.v1'],
  ),
)

// 2. Read it from the contract — getPositionHash(user, pairBase, isLong, lvToken)
// 3. Read open positions — getPositionsV4(user, pairBase)

After sending

Closing is a request. The keeper settles it and emits:

EventMeaning
CloseTradeRequestedYour transaction was accepted
ClosePositionPosition fully closed and settled
PositionDecreasedPartial close settled, remainder still open
ExecuteCloseRejectedClose could not be settled

ClosePosition and PositionDecreased carry a CloseInfo with the realized numbers:

solidity
struct CloseInfo {
    uint128 closePrice;  // 1e18
    int96 fundingFee;    // lvToken decimals, signed
    uint96 closeFee;     // lvToken decimals
    int96 pnl;           // lvToken decimals, signed
    uint96 holdingFee;   // lvToken decimals
}

Common reverts

ErrorCause
NonexistentTradePosition already closed, or wrong hash
PositionNotCloseableMinimum holding period not elapsed — check earliestCloseTime
MarketClosedMarket outside trading hours
CoolingOffPeriodAction temporarily unavailable
